Mountain Hares-Coignafearn
High in the hills of Coignafearn, mountain hares are perfectly adapted to the wild Highland landscape. During winter, their coats turn almost completely white, providing remarkable camouflage against the snow. Watching these hardy animals shelter from the wind, bound across the hillside or quietly rest among the heather is a wonderful reminder of the resilience of Scotland’s mountain wildlife.
